IRAN, Nasir al-din Shah (A.H.1264-1313) (A.D. 1848-1896), two toman another one toman both A.H.1299 = 1881-2, (KM. Y.18-19), another Ahmad Shah (A.H.1327-1344) (A.D. 1909-1925), fifth toman A.H.1337 = 1918-9, (KM. Y.79). Second coin has been mounted, otherwise very fine or better. (3)
